4-48B-24. Revenue bonds; exemption from taxation.

The revenue bonds issued under authority of the Hospital Funding Act [Chapter 4, Article 48B NMSA 1978] and the income from the bonds, all mortgages or other security instruments executed as security for the bonds, all agreement [agreements] made pursuant to the provisions of that act and the revenues derived therefrom by a county shall be exempt from all taxation by the state or any political subdivision thereof.
